Cremax Cream is comprehensive care to damaged skin; It has both restoring and moistening ability to sensitive and dry skin.
- Allantoin: it has restoring effect, it is derivated from the oxidation of uric acid, and it is used topically to remove the damaged tissues.
- Zinc oxide: it has a mildastringent effect and demonstrated success in restoring non-mixed superficial ulcerations, and it has a protective effect from Ultra Violet rays.
- Talc: it has a hygroscopic effect.
